The setting up and running a recovery hub for wildlife demands meticulous planning of numerous factors, from facility design to staffing needs and persistent methods in operations. Modern facilities such as African Wildlife Foundation are equipped with intentional habitats that mimic biological environs while providing necessary medical access, with diverse zones for isolation, care, and early freedom training.

These centers work with cross-discipline groups including veterinarians, animal behaviorists, nutritionists, and rehabilitation specialists who work collaboratively to draft custom care schedules. The renewal journey adheres to verified guidelines while assuring extensive health attention and manner adaptations. Advanced monitoring systems keep track of healing advancements via thorough documentation and normal reviews, allowing data-driven decisions about release readiness. Educational programmes and creature well-being approaches integrated into these centres fulfill two objectives of raising public awareness and producing critical finances through visitor programmes and adoption schemes. The success of rehabilitation efforts is measured not only by release rates but also by long-term survival studies tracking animals post-release, providing valuable insights for continuous improvement of rehabilitation methodologies.

Wildlife rescue efforts have actually become more advanced, incorporating advanced veterinary techniques and specialist devices to meet the intricate requirements of hurt creatures and orphaned wildlife. Modern rescue squads employ advanced healthcare institutions, including digital radiography, surgical suites, and high-care wards developed primarily for various species. The process initiates with rapid action plans that ensure quick deployment to incident sites, whether dealing with oil spills affecting marine life, car accidents with big animals, or natural disasters displacing entire populations. Learning modules for saving employees have evolved to feature classes on creature conduct, tension alleviation methods, and species-specific handling methods. These extensive approaches significantly improve survival rates and reduce the psychological trauma experienced by rescued animals. The integration of mobile veterinary units has revolutionized field operations, enabling instant healthcare access in distant sites. Furthermore, partnerships with local communities developed broad webs of qualified assistants acting as initial reactants, dramatically reducing response times and improving outcomes for animals in distress.

Full-scale animal safeguarding solutions from organizations like Snow Leopard Trust cover an extensive range of tasks designed to safeguard species and their habitats through proactive intervention and watchful protocols. These solutions cover de-snaring campaigns employing top-tier watching gear like thermal imaging cameras, drone patrols, and GPS tracking systems providing real-time intelligence on illicit issues. Environment safeguarding projects entail cooperation with landowners, state organizations, and conservation organizations to establish protected corridors and carry out renewable earth administration techniques. Species-specific protection programmes attend to distinct requirements of threatened groups via specific solutions like nest monitoring, breeding programmes, and renewal strategies. The integration of community-based conservation approaches has proven particularly effective, engaging local populations as active participants in safeguarding attempts instead of uninterested witnesses. Training programmes for local rangers and community members teach crucial abilities in fauna tracking, information gathering, and dispute settling. Normal community reviews and body checks offer key insights for flexible control methods, while public education campaigns raise awareness about the importance of wildlife protection and promote here responsible behavior in natural environments.

Animal preservation stands for a diversified pathway that combines scientific research, habitat management, and community engagement to promise extended continuation of organisms and biosystems. Modern preservation plans utilize genetic analysis, population modeling, and climate change projections to develop comprehensive management plans that address both current threats and future challenges. Joint global schemes foster information exchange and align missions beyond sovereign borders, recognizing that wildlife populations often transcend national borders. The execution of preservation breeding blueprints has proven successful for numerous critically endangered species, meticulously maintaining genetic variety and re-entry schedules. Environment renewal undertakings incorporate ecological principles and native species propagation to recreate functional ecosystems that support diverse wildlife communities. Innovative funding mechanisms, including payments for ecosystem services and conservation easements, supply enduring fiscal backing for prolonged safeguarding missions. Modern tools have a growing importance, with satellite monitoring, automated camera traps, and acoustic observation systems offering unmatched understanding about animal actions and group characteristics.
